What is / are the advantage/s of a circuit breaker over a fuse?
a. It can act as a switch
63 b. Its position can be easily detected (close/open) All of these
c. It can be used again after fault has been corrected
d. All of these

This is used to supply a single phase lighting load and three phase power load DELTA-DELTA FOR
163
simultaneously POWER AND LIGHTING

This connection is used when single phase lighting load is large as compared with the OPEN DELTA FOR
164
power load LIGHTING AND POWER

Often it is desirable to increase the voltage of a circuit form a 2400 to 4160 volts to
165 Y DELTA FOR POWER
increase its potential capacity

This connection is similar to the delta-delta bank with only the primary connection changed
The primary neutral should not be grounded or tied into the system neutral, since a single Y DELTA FOR LIGHTING
166
phase ground fault may result in extensive blowing of fuses throughout the system This AND POWER
connection requires special watt-hour metering

When operating Y delta and one service is disabled, service maybe maintained at reduced
167 OPEN Y DELTA
load
The single phase lighting load is all on one phase resulting in unblanced primary currents DELTA Y FOR LIGHTING
168
in any one bank AND POWER

The primary voltage was increased from 2400 to 4160 volts to increase the potential Y-Y FOR LIGHTING AND
169
capacity of the system POWER
When the ratio of transformation from the primary to secondary voltage is small, the
170 Y-Y AUTO TRANSFORMER
most economical way of stepping down the voltage
SCOTT CONNECTION
171 In some localities two phase power is required from three phase system
3PHASE TO 2PHASE
If it should be necessary to supply three phase power from a two phase system, the special SCOTT CONNECTED
172
tap must be provided on the secondary side 2PHASE TO 3PHASE

Fabricated assembly of insulated conductors enclosed in flexible metal sheath. It is used


194 ARMOR CABLE (AC)
both on exposed and concealed work

A factory assemble cable of one or more conductors each individualy insulated and
195 enclosed in a mettalic sheath of interlocking tape of smooth or corrugated tube. This type of METAL CLAD CABLE (MC)
cable is especially used for service feeders, branch circuit and for indoor, outdoor work

Is a factory assembly of one or more conductors insulated with highly compressed


refractory mineral insulation enclosed in a liquid and gas tight continous copper sheath. This MINERAL INSULATED
196
type of cable is used in dry, wet or continously moist location as service feeders or branch CABLE (MI)
circuit

Is a also a factory assembly of two or more insulated conductors having a moisture


NON METALLIC SHEATED
197 resistant, flame retardant and non metallic material outer sheath. This type is used
CABLE (NM)
specifically for one or two family dwellings not exceeding 3 storey building

This type of cable is factory assembly of two or more insulated conductors in an extruded
SHIELDED NON METALLIC
198 core of moisture resistant and flame retardant material covered within an overlapping spiral
SHEATED CABLE (SNM)
metal tape. This type is used in hazardous locations and in cable trays or in raceways

Is a moisture resistant cable used for underground connections including direct burial in UNDERGROUND FEEDER
the ground as feeder or branch circuit This is factory assembled two or more insulated AND BRANCH CIRCUIT
199 conductors with or without associated bare or covered or grounding under a mettalic (UF) POWER AND
sheath, This is used for installation of cable trays, raceways, or it is supported by CONTROL TRAY CABLE
messenger wire (TC)

Is an assembly of parallel conductors formed integrally with insulating material web FLAT CABLE ASSEMBLY
200
designed especially for field installation in metal surface or raceways (FC)

8/16
PREPARED BY:
ALEXANDER SAN ANDRES
ELECTRICAL REVIEWER

Consist of three or more flat copper conductor placed edge to edge separated and
enclosed with an insulating assembly. This type of cable is used for general purposes such FLAT CONDUCTOR
201
as: appliance branch circuit, and for individual branch circuits, especially in hard smooth CABLE (FCC)
continous floor surfaces and the like

Is a single or multi conductor solid dielectric insulated cable rated at 2,000 volts or higher. MEDIUM VOLTAGE CABLE
202
This type is used for power system up to 35,000 volts (MV)

299 A type of perimeter detector which detects object in heat range of body temperature. Passive Infrared

300 A type of perimeter detector which detects interruption of light beam. Light Beam

301 A type of perimeter detector which detects change in sound wave pattern. Ultrasonic

A box with a blank cover which serves the purpose of joining one different runs of raceways
302 or cables and provided with sufficient space for connection and branching of the enclosed Pull Box
conductors.

A type of perimeter detector which is subject to false alarm from aircraft radar and from
303 Microwave
movement outside building through window, wood doors, and the like. It uses radio waves.

304 This type of perimeter detector uses both the Passive infrared and Ultrasonic or Passive Infrared with

Ultrasonic (or
305 Microwave system.
Microwave)

This type of perimeter detector detects a change in capacitance of the area covered,
306 Proximity / Capacitance
caused by intrusion.

A high intensity discharge lamp in which the light is produced by the radiation from a mixture
307 Metal Halide Lamp
of a metallic vapor, similar to that of a mercury lamp in construction.

A type of lamp popular for lighting commercial interiors, uses argon gas to ease starting, it
308 Mercury Lamp
produces light by means of an electric discharge in mercury vapor.

A type of lamp which produces light by means of the reaction of halogen additive in the bulb Tungsten Halogen
309
reacts with chemically with tungsten. Lamp

High-Pressure-Sodium
310 A type of lamp generally used for roadways and sidewalks, uses sodium gas.
(HPS)
